Teachers are bombarded with new applications every day. Some love the challenge of learning new things, and some don’t. That’s why Edsby works hard to support all your educators as they learn Edsby, offering a variety of ways to help everyone get comfortable with the system in a way that works best for them.
To make things simple to begin with, Edsby was designed to work like the social media systems teachers already know and use. Who needed a lot of training to use Facebook?
There’s a tour built into the Edsby product. First time users are stepped through the basics of many areas of Edsby and can review anytime they like. With videos.
Prepackaged FAQs and dozens of training videos illustrate aspects of Edsby for teachers, admins, parents and students.
Edsby can perform onsite or remote training for large organizations, often led by former teachers. Extensive training materials, including workbooks, are provided.
A series of training courses are built right into Edsby. Educators can work through them as they have the time.
Edsby can create videos using an organization’s specific language and messaging to make the introduction of Edsby easier for local teachers, students and parents.
Organizations can create a group in their Edsby systems for internal Edsby Q&A.
Designated representatives in your team can connect with Edsby support personnel to obtain answers to your educators’ specific questions. Get real answers from real people.
Customers can receive a private Edsby server mirroring the organization’s customizations so teachers and others can learn Edsby without compromising live student data.
